What Exactly is “Mudding” in Film?
At its core, mudding refers to the deliberate strategies filmmakers use to confuse, challenge, or twist viewers’ perception. It’s a psychological hack: by manipulating pacing, narrative structure, sound design, and visual cues, directors push audiences outside their comfort zones. Instead of passive watching, viewers become active participants, piecing together truths buried beneath layers of ambiguity.

1. Unreliable Narration: When You Can’t Trust What You See
Mudding often begins with voiceover, fragmented dialogue, or shifting perspectives. Directors like Christopher Nolan in Memento or Denis Villeneuve in Prisoners use nonlinear timelines and unstable narrators to make audiences question reality. Which version of events is true? Who can you believe? This deliberate confusion mimics real-life cognitive dissonance, forcing viewers to engage critically.

2. Sensory Overload and Disorientation
Fast cuts, conflicting audio tracks, and jarring visual distortions overwhelm the senses. Think of the chaotic traffic montage in Heat or the surreal dream sequences in Inception. By disrupting sensory expectations, filmmakers trigger a primal alertness—your brain struggles to process conflicting inputs, heightening emotional intensity. Science suggests such sensory stress amplifies memory retention and emotional engagement.
3. Emotional Tunnel Vision Through Narrative Jumps
Mudding deliberately withholds context. A sudden jump to flashbacks, sudden character shifts, or cryptic symbolism can “muddle” your emotional grip. In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ind, fragmented memories leave viewers emotionally disoriented—but deeply empathetic. You’re forced to feel the chaos, not just understand it.
4. Ambiguity That Lingers Long After the Credits Roll
Unlike neatly resolved fandoms, mudded endings invite interpretation. Films like Arrival or Blade Runner 2049 avoid easy answers, leaving key questions open. This ambiguity doesn’t frustrate viewers—it haunts them. Mudding extends the story beyond the screen, making audiences revisit scenes, debate theories, and deepen their relationship with the film.

Why Does Mudding Work So Well?
Psychologically, mudding taps into our brain’s natural desire for pattern recognition and closure. When presented with incomplete or conflicting information, the mind scrambles to make sense—activating areas linked to problem-solving, empathy, and emotional processing. This mental workout creates an intense, personal connection, turning viewers into co-creators of meaning.
Beyond cognitive impact, mudding transforms movies into cultural moments. These twists aren’t just tricks—they’re invitations to explore complexity, confront uncertainty, and rediscover storytelling’s power.
